Like previous editions, COMMERCIAL BANK MANAGEMENT, Third Edition, is designed to help those students who are thinking about a career in banking and professionals in the banking field by providing them with a view of the subject from the perspective of both a bank customer and bank manager. Rose gives students insight into modern issues such as interstate banking, risk management, global banking, technological advancements, and government deregulation_issues bankers must confront every day. The text demonstrates the critical role banks play in determining standard of living, availability of jobs, and overall function of business. It contains a balance of theoretical and analytical material, which provides students with the tools they need to understand modern banking. For those already employed in banking, the book will improve management skills and keep them up to date on the most current trends in banking. It is used in undergraduate and MBA level courses in commercial banking, as well as in financial institutions courses, when the emphasis is on commercial banking.

New and updated discussion of legislation that has impacted the banking industry.
New material on mergers, acquisitions and the consolidation impacting the banking environment.
Expanded global coverage integrated throughout the text.
Marginal definitions placed next to where new terms and concepts introduced.
Discusses the challenges banks face from non-bank competitors, such as mutual funds and pension funds, offering stocks, bonds and mutual funds as an attractive alternative to traditional bank deposits.
Each chapter opens with Learning and Management Decision Objectives, which describe the principal goal of each chapter.
Concept checks are included after each major section to help determine whether the reader understands the material just presented.
Includes a generous number of end-of-chapter problems, as well as extensive references. Many of the problems offer alternative scenarios, illustrating what happens if the facts involved shift or the assumptions suddenly change.
Numerous diagrams, exhibits, tables, and real-world examples from the banking industry are integrated to clarify important points.
Two cases appear at the end of the text: one dealing with the emergence of Internet banking, featuring Wingspan.com; the other deals with the dynamics of banking relationships and features Be Our Guest, Inc. The solutions to the cases are found in the instructor's manual.
Completely updated edition to reflect rapidly changing banking/financial services arena.
New material on the competitive challenges posed by non-banking competitors.
Internet activities and URLs in special pedagogical boxes found in each chapter.
